AI agents blew the whistle on their cheating colleagues

AI agents blew the whistle on their cheating colleagues

Quick summary

A group of AI agents asked to solve a series of math problems split into rival factions—when some cheated, others tried to stop them. That whistleblowing behavior, seen for the first time in a recent experiment run by Google DeepMind, could have implications for alignment researchers trying to keep swarms of autonomous AI agents in…
